In the journey of love, relationships can sometimes drift into a state of complacency. The initial sparks that once lit the flame may diminish as life’s responsibilities take center stage. While it’s normal for relationships to go through ebbs and flows, it’s crucial to revive that emotional connection and reignite the passion. Here are some practical tips for women to strengthen their emotional bonds and restore intimacy in their relationships.
1. Communicate Openly and Honestly
Effective communication is the cornerstone of any successful relationship. Take the time to discuss your feelings, desires, and concerns with your partner. Be honest about what you need emotionally and encourage your partner to do the same. Schedule regular check-ins where both of you can express yourselves freely without fear of judgment. This open dialogue fosters trust and helps to deepen your emotional connection.
2. Show Appreciation and Affection
Often, we take our partners for granted and forget to express gratitude for their presence in our lives. Make a conscious effort to acknowledge the small things they do for you. A simple “thank you,” a compliment, or a loving gesture can go a long way. Physical touch is also important; hugs, kisses, and cuddles can reignite feelings of closeness and affection.
3. Create Special Moments Together
In our busy lives, it’s easy to let quality time slide down the priority list. However, creating special moments can help reignite your relationship. Plan date nights, weekend getaways, or even spontaneous adventures together. Engaging in shared activities, whether trying a new cuisine or taking a dance class, brings excitement and strengthens your bond.
4. Address Underlying Issues
Sometimes, emotional distance stems from unresolved conflicts or unmet needs. It’s crucial to address these issues openly and constructively. Rather than assigning blame, use “I” statements to express your feelings. For example, say “I feel neglected when we don’t spend time together” instead of “You never make time for me.” This approach minimizes defensiveness and encourages understanding.

5. Revisit Your Shared Goals and Dreams
Take the time to discuss your aspirations, both as individuals and as a couple. What dreams have you set aside? What goals do you want to achieve together? Reassessing your goals can rekindle the excitement in the relationship as you work towards something meaningful side by side.
6. Embrace Vulnerability
Vulnerability can create a deeper emotional connection. Share your fears, hopes, and insecurities with your partner. This openness can encourage them to be vulnerable in return. When both partners feel safe and supported, it fosters a stronger emotional bond, allowing you to navigate challenges together.
7. Focus on Self-Care
While it’s important to nurture your relationship, taking care of yourself is equally vital. Engage in activities that make you feel good about yourself, whether it’s pursuing a hobby, exercising, or spending time with friends. A healthy, happy individual contributes positively to a relationship, allowing for deeper connections.
8. Seek Professional Guidance if Necessary
If you find that the emotional distance is challenging to navigate alone, consider seeking help from a couples therapist. A professional can offer tools and insights that may facilitate effective communication and resolution of conflicts.
Reigniting a relationship may require effort and commitment, but the rewards can be invaluable. By applying these practical tips, women can take the initiative to restore emotional bonds, bringing back the intimacy and connection that may have faded over time. Remember, love is a journey, and nurturing it requires intention and care.
